Output 28a150fb71df3df57ef2a7d7c00a5949902a113d68ef65ed238c8a5d531ce9b4:0

value
39462321
script pubkey
OP_0 OP_PUSHBYTES_20 c1369584f8133456bc0e49d7d26909b80af59d66
address
bc1qcymftp8czv69d0qwf8tay6gfhq90t8tx7gee2z
transaction
28a150fb71df3df57ef2a7d7c00a5949902a113d68ef65ed238c8a5d531ce9b4
confirmations
265497
spent
true